Output e8ab8a9c378d05170a0f7656bb249b1e1bb6e083f8a6c229a29b50a69a17f371:1

value
813635127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 babd5d8b4e11ded4254c1858d6d246ce5243cb8e OP_EQUAL
address
3JiQTZdM4eDC88b5493ywV7hN59bad4hgo
transaction
e8ab8a9c378d05170a0f7656bb249b1e1bb6e083f8a6c229a29b50a69a17f371